Make completion prefix matching case insensitive.

This commit is contained in:
steveluc
2015-03-23 17:25:45 -07:00
parent ae4f164eb2
commit 7b824bac41

View File

@@ -550,7 +550,7 @@ module ts.server {
}
return completions.entries.reduce((result: protocol.CompletionEntry[], entry: ts.CompletionEntry) => {
if (completions.isMemberCompletion || entry.name.indexOf(prefix) == 0) {
if (completions.isMemberCompletion || (entry.name.toLowerCase().indexOf(prefix.toLowerCase()) == 0)) {
result.push(entry);
}
return result;